James Coley was a part of Kirby Smart's initial staff at Georgia and spent four years with the program. Now he's back after some time at Texas A&M and he's coaching wide receivers. DawgsHQ's Rusty Mansell and Jake Rowe discuss that and they into what Coley brings to the table. They also give an update on the open running backs coach job, one that was filled soon after the show ended when the Bulldogs tapped Josh Crawford to take the job.
